Parks & Recreation 

Golf lovers, rejoice! Located in the center of the neighborhood, the 27-hole West Woods Golf Club offers an abundance of opportunities for you to improve your swing. There is also an extensive system of neighborhood parks within and beyond West Woods to explore for family outings, picnics, and solitary explorations. Housing 

West Woods offers a range of housing options to fit your needs and lifestyle, catering to a wide range of housing preferences. Most homes in the neighborhood are single-family homes with modern or traditional ranch-style architecture. You may also find townhouses or condominiums in some parts of West Woods for a smaller, easier-to-maintain living space.

Open floor plans are common in the neighborhood’s modern homes, giving residents a feeling of space and a closer-knit community. Some homes let you enjoy scenic views with large windows and outdoor living areas. Attached or detached garages are a common feature of West Woods homes, offering residents extra storage space and easy parking.

History 

The history of Arvada, Colorado, is deeply intertwined with the tale of West Woods. The 1850s gold rush in nearby Clear Creek drew settlers and laid the groundwork for the eventual development of Arvada. The region was originally an agricultural community with a large emphasis on farming and ranching.

The year 1870 saw Arvada formally become a town, a significant turning point in the city’s development. The town’s economic landscape changed as various industries arose, such as coal mines and brick factories. The town was once an industrial hub, but with the decline of mining and the rise of suburban development, it became a thriving residential community.
